But once you enter the world of online sports betting, one question always comes up: should you choose a single bet or a parlay?

At the most basic level, a single bet means placing money on one outcome. If that prediction is correct, you win based on the listed odds. A parlay, on the other hand, combines multiple selections into one ticket. Every selection must win for the bet to pay out.

Key differences between single and parlay bets

  • A single bet involves one event only
  • A parlay combines two or more events
  • Single bets offer lower risk
  • Parlays offer higher potential payouts
  • Parlays require all predictions to be correct

Understanding these fundamentals is the first step toward deciding which option fits your style and comfort level.

How Single Bets Work and Why Many Players Prefer Them

Single bets are straightforward. You pick one match, one market, and one outcome. If you win, you get paid. If you lose, the bet ends there. There is no chain reaction of results affecting your ticket.

For many online game players, this simplicity is attractive. There is less stress because your focus stays on one event. You can analyze statistics, team performance, injuries, and other factors without worrying about how multiple games connect.

Advantages of choosing single bets

  • Easier to analyze and manage
  • Lower overall risk
  • More consistent long-term results
  • Suitable for beginners
  • Clear win-or-lose outcome

A player who places five separate single bets still has the chance to win some even if others fail. That flexibility makes bankroll management much easier.

How Parlay Bets Increase Risk and Reward

Parlay betting works differently. You combine multiple selections into one wager. The odds multiply together, creating a much higher payout compared to placing each bet separately.

The appeal is obvious. A small stake can potentially bring a large return. However, the catch is simple: every prediction must be correct. If just one selection loses, the entire bet loses.

Characteristics of parlay betting

  • Higher potential payout
  • Higher overall risk
  • One mistake cancels the entire ticket
  • More exciting but less predictable
  • Often used for entertainment value

For players who enjoy the thrill of high-risk betting, parlays can be exciting. But excitement does not always equal profitability.
